2016 Jeep Grand Cherokee fuel consumption
9 versions rated. Official figures from the Australian Government’s Green Vehicle Guide.
Fuel use, combined
7.5–14.0 L/100km
lower is better
Cost to run a year
$2,510–$3,626
at 14,000km
CO₂ from the exhaust
198–327 g/km
per kilometre
About average for a 2016 car, which used 7.3 L/100km.
Every 2016 Jeep Grand Cherokee version
| Version | Engine | Fuel use | City | Highway | Cost/year | CO₂ |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Laredo SUV Auto | 3L 6cyl Turbo Diesel | 7.5 | 9.3 | 6.5 | $2,510 | 198 Slightly worse than average |
| Limited SUV Auto | 3L 6cyl Turbo Diesel | 7.5 | 9.3 | 6.5 | $2,510 | 198 Slightly worse than average |
| Overland SUV Auto | 3L 6cyl Turbo Diesel | 7.5 | 9.3 | 6.5 | $2,510 | 198 Slightly worse than average |
| Summit SUV Auto | 3L 6cyl Turbo Diesel | 7.5 | 9.3 | 6.5 | $2,510 | 198 Slightly worse than average |
| Trailhawk SUV Auto | 3L 6cyl Turbo Diesel | 7.5 | 9.3 | 6.5 | $2,510 | 198 Slightly worse than average |
| 3.6 Laredo SUV Auto | 3.6L 6cyl Petrol 91RON | 10.0 | 13.5 | 8.0 | $2,590 | 233 Worse than average |
| 3.6 Limited SUV Auto | 3.6L 6cyl Petrol 91RON | 10.0 | 13.5 | 8.0 | $2,590 | 233 Worse than average |
| 3.6 Overland SUV Auto | 3.6L 6cyl Petrol 91RON | 10.0 | 13.5 | 8.0 | $2,590 | 233 Worse than average |
| SRT SUV Auto | 6.4L 8cyl Petrol 91RON | 14.0 | 20.7 | 10.1 | $3,626 | 327 Worse than average |

Figures come from a standardised laboratory test, so every car is measured the same way. Your own fuel use will differ with traffic, load, tyre pressure and how you drive. Running costs assume 14,000km a year at recent average fuel prices.
